When I was assigned to test the 2009 Harley Davidson Electra Glide Classic, my curiosity and the exuberant encouragement from my wife (Jane) made the decision to accept the assignment simple.
Harley Davidson has taken its classic touring line and made some significant improvements. Never having ridden an Electra Glide, many of these improvements assuredly are less noticeable to me than an experienced Harley rider, but I can see that the changes make moving from my normal sport touring (Kawasaki Concours 14) and adventure bike (Ducati Multistrada 1100) milieu to a luxury cruiser touring bike less drastic. I was forewarned that the intense vibration at idle disappears once the bike reaches operating speed, so I was unconcerned.
A few minutes spent in a nearby mall parking lot gave me the confidence to take the Electra Glide onto the highway. Of course, the highway is where you really learn to feel comfortable on this bike.
The early morning traffic afforded liberal use of the electronic cruise control and sixth gear making the ride almost effortless. The stability of the Electra Glide provided by its mass and superbly designed suspension made the seventy miles of highway pass quickly. I noted that the stereo controls on the throttle side are easier to reach than the cruise control switches, which are on the same side. The narrow, snow lined two lane roads up from Yucaipa to Oak Glen proved less intimidating than I had anticipated on the big bike.
Easing the Electra Glide into the tight parking lot of Oak Tree Village brought back some of the trepidation I originally felt when getting accustomed to the bike. The low seat height in conjunction with the wide floorboards made walking the bike awkward so I found it beneficial to maintain enough speed to keep the bike upright until in position to stop. Over lunch, Jane and I discussed our impressions of the Electra Glide Classic. Jane, to my surprise, likes speed and enjoys the back of a sport touring bike. I was concerned that the lackadaisical nature of a big touring bike may not provide as thrilling an experience as she desires but to the contrary, Jane was exuberant in her praise of the Electra Glide. Fortunately, Harley Davidson provides a rich line of motorcycles that give long distance comfort with an ever increasing eye on performance.
After wrapping up lunch, Jane and I opted out of our normal role as tourist at Oak Glen in favor of spending more time on the Harley Davidson Electra Glide Classic. The bike begs to be ridden and rewards you for doing so.
